Why Stay in Plaka?
Plaka is an ideal location for travelers who want to experience the authentic charm of Athens. This historic neighborhood offers:
- Unbeatable proximity to the Acropolis and the Parthenon
- A plethora of traditional tavernas, restaurants, and cafes
- Narrow streets and alleys filled with souvenir shops, boutiques, and local artisans
- A vibrant nightlife with bars, clubs, and live music venues
- Easy access to other popular attractions, such as the Ancient Agora and the Temple of Olympian Zeus

What is the best area to stay in Plaka Athens?
When it comes to staying in Plaka Athens, the best area to stay is in the heart of the historic neighborhood, which offers easy access to the Acropolis, Monastiraki Flea Market, and other popular attractions. Look for hotels on Adrianou Street, Kidathineon Street, or Nikis Street for a convenient and immersive experience.
What is the average cost of a hotel room in Plaka Athens?
The average cost of a hotel room in Plaka Athens can vary depending on the time of year, room type, and amenities. However, you can expect to pay around €80-€150 per night for a mid-range hotel, while luxury hotels can range from €250-€500 per night.
